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United StatesStreet access to I-5 is a little inconvenient, but I've been there enough to know I just need to go one street over to hit a light.
The staff here are always friendly and accommodating. They always take care of any special needs I may have. The price is economical and always have something to grab for breakfast. Parking is easy although the street isn't the most accessible, but it's not the hotel's fault. I make frequent trips up I-5 and this hotel is at a good location for me to stop. Close enough to downtown and places to eat. I almost always stay here when passing through the area.
